Event details

Mad Meadows is a trail running event on October 10, 2026, near Leavenworth, Washington. The start and finish are at Grouse Creek Group Campground on Chiwawa River Road. Distances offered:

  • 50K - 7000 ft elevation gain
  • 50M - 11,000 ft elevation gain

Course and terrain

The course runs on remote alpine ridgelines and through meadows and river valleys. Terrain includes smooth single track, steep climbs, technical sections, pumice slopes from a past Dakobed eruption, talus slopes, and winding descents on ridges such as Garland Ridge, Chikamin Ridge, and Alder Ridge. Notable features and viewpoints include the Mad River, Mad Meadows, views into the Entiat River Valley, and toward Clark Mountain and Dakobed (Glacier Peak). The 50K route reaches elevations over 6000 ft; the 50M route tops out over 7000 ft. Portions of the route use Chiwawa River Road and include long road sections and out-and-back connections between aid stations.

Aid stations, logistics, and rules

Multiple aid stations are located along each course; some stations are water-only and one is a hike-in station with limited items. Basalt and Chikamin aid stations offer hot food. The event is cupless; runners must carry refillable containers. Pacers are not allowed. Crew access is limited to specific aid stations. Drop bag and required-gear rules differ by distance, including mandatory rain/wind layer, water capacity, and having the course GPS loaded on a device.
